/**多tomcat配置(举例两个更多以此类推)*/
每个tomcat对应一个文件夹不能再tomcat文件夹下面建立文件夹再放一个tomcat

vim /etc/profile




在最后加入以下代码(前面不要留空格)


##########first tomcat##########
CATALINA_BASE=/home/tomcat/hbManage
CATALINA_HOME=/home/tomcat/hbManage
TOMCAT_HOME=/home/tomcat/hbManage/
export CATALINA_BASE CATALINA_HOME TOMCAT_HOME
##########first tomcat##########
##########second tomcat##########
CATALINA_2_BASE=/home/tomcat/hbWeb
CATALINA_2_HOME=/home/tomcat/hbWeb
TOMCAT_2_HOME=/home/tomcat/hbWeb
export CATALINA_2_BASE CATALINA_2_HOME TOMCAT_2_HOME
##########second tomcat##########




然后保存文件退出


再到第二个tomcat/bin目录中的catalina.sh中加入


在大约97行处加入以下代码


export CATALINA_BASE=$CATALINA_2_BASE
export CATALINA_HOME=$CATALINA_2_HOME

在最后加入


export JAVA_HOME=/usr/java/jdk1.7.0_79
export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
export CLASSPATH=: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ib

这是Java的环境变量



最后把tomcat_2/conf下的server.xml打开


修改shudown端口与启动端口。这样就可以在linux下同时运行两个tomcat了。运行更多tomcat方法是一样的。


例如


Tomcat1端口分配表(tomcat1全部采用默认配置)




端口                      端口号




关闭指令端口               8005




http端口                   8080




https端口                  8443




Ajp端口                    8009




Tomcat2端口分配表




端口                      端口号




关闭指令端口               8006




http端口                   8081




https端口                  8444




Ajp端口                    8010






/**防火墙添加开放端口*/


-A INPUT -p tcp -m state --state NEW -m tcp --dport 8080 -j ACCEPT


-A INPUT -p tcp -m state --state NEW -m tcp --dport 8081 -j ACCEPT




/**配置完这些参数最好重启服务器*/


reboot 



   /**重启防火墙 */


    查看状态 service  iptables  status 


 开启: service iptables start 


 关闭: service iptables stop 



/**重启httpd命令*/



service httpd start 启动


service httpd restart 重新启动


service httpd stop 停止服务




/**重启服务器*/


reboot




/**查看tomcat进程*/


ps -ef |grep tomcat




pscp 上传文件


/** 前面是win的本地路径*/                        /**后面是远端目录*/


pscp C:\Users\Admin\Desktop\hbWeb.war root@125.64.41.184:/usr/tomcat1/tomcat-7.0.64-2/webapps/


pscp C:\Users\Admin\Desktop\huibw\hbManager.war root@125.64.41.184:/usr/local/tomcat-7.0.64-1/webapps/


阿里云国内75折 回扣 微信号:monov8
阿里云国际,腾讯云国际,低至75折。AWS 93折 免费开户实名账号 代冲值 优惠多多 微信号:monov8 飞机:@monov6
标签: Tomcat